
Wall Street and the financial district are the heart of the financial world in the United States. Your trip to New York will take a powerful and exciting turn with a visit to the district.
The New York Stock Exchange is perhaps the most iconic destination on Wall Street and while the inside is no longer open to the public, you can still catch daily walking tours of the entire financial district as a whole. Some of the most important stops to make are at the Federal Reserve Bank of New York (which is open for tours) and the Museum of American Finance, which offers an inside look behind the workings of Wall Street.
The New York Stock Exchange itself is, of course, where all the trading happens and where billions of dollars trade hands every day. While you can no longer go inside, just seeing the outside of this massive building is enough to make your trip to New York. The photo opportunities are great here, especially with the humongous American flag draped across the building’s façade.
